The Carter Inn
4.9/552 Reviews
I stayed here when I was riding the BDR trail on my dirtbike. The owners live in location so they are always available. Check in: Fast and easy. Very friendly and helpful. The stay: The room was clean, didn't smell gross, and had some fresh updates. The bed was comfortable and the sheets were nice as well. I walked over to the sleepy coyote for a bite to eat. Very good. The town only has 246 people, so everything is in walking distance. The next morning: Breakfast is included with the stay. This is where this place shines as well. They open up a room for you to go sit in to eat. They made me eggs and sausage to order. They also had homemade pastries, homemade sourdough bread, and homemade jam. I ate my breakfast, sat and talked with the owners for a bit as well. Overall: The Carter Inn is fantastic. I would stay here again in a heartbeat. The owners truly know great customer service and make sure their guests' needs and wants are taken care of. There are only 8 rooms so make sure and book early! Thanks again!

Elk Country Inn
4.3/5121 Reviews
We stayed one night in a loft room which was a great BIG room but it had the tiniest bathroom I have ever seen in a hotel room. If you had two people (like trying to give a child a bath) you would have to either keep the door open or one person would have to stand in the bath while the second person came in in order to close the door. It was strange for how big the rest of the room was. Be advised all loft rooms are on the second floor and there is no elevator. They did have a coin operated laundry, only two and one of the dryers was out of service. Had to wait for a hotel employee to finish his laundry before I could use dryer. Nice breakfast only 6:30 - 9:30am. Comfortable beds, clean. Not really close to main square but it is walking distance (little over 1/2 mile). TV would blink to black screen while watching then would come back which was annoying. No no commercial channel (like movie channels) option for TV. Front desk staff were friendly. Really LOUD housekeepers yelling back and forth to each other on deck outside room early in the morning, so much for sleeping in. The hotel lobby is really pretty/nice but expected more for the really expensive price.
